Normani Reveals She Had To Cancel BET Awards Performance After ‘Really Bad Accident’
HuffPost
“I am more frustrated and disappointed than anyone believe me,” the singer wrote on social media.
Normani has opened up about why her BET Awards performance was nixed at the last minute.
Just before Sunday’s ceremony in Los Angeles, the singer, 28, announced on social media that a “really bad accident” during rehearsals had left her injured and unable to hit the stage.
“I am more frustrated and disappointed than anyone believe me,” Normani wrote in her Instagram Stories. “While in rehearsals for BET I had a really bad accident and injured myself.”
The “Worth It” crooner admitted that she’s “normally good for powering through under any circumstance,” but due to her doctor’s orders, she was “just not able to make this performance happen.”
Normani also shared a photo of herself on crutches with a bandage around her right knee and what appeared to be a boot on her right foot.
